# 使用Jinja模板在Python中创建表单 Jinja是一个用于Python的流行的模板引擎,它允许在HTML文件中插入变量、控制结构和过滤器。结合Jinja和Python可以轻松地创建动态的表单页面。在本文中,我们将介绍如何使用Jinja模板在Python中创建一个简单的表单,并通过一个代码示例详细展示整个过程。 ## 准备工作 在开始之前,我们需要安装Jinja2模块。你可以使用pi
原创 2024-03-25 07:32:39
63阅读
# 使用 Jinja2 实现简单模板引擎 ## 引言 在 web 开发中,模板引擎是一个不可或缺的组件,它能简化动态网页的生成过程。在 Python 中,Jinja2 是一个流行的模板引擎,它以其高效、易用的特点被广泛应用。本文将指导你如何使用 Jinja2 进行基本的模板渲染,帮助你在项目中灵活运用。 ## 过程概述 首先,我们来看一下实现 Jinja2 的基本步骤: | 步骤 | 描
原创 10月前
66阅读
简介对于jinjia2来说,模板仅仅是文本文件,可以生成任何基于文本的文件格式,例如HTML、XML、CSV、LaTex 等等,以下是基础的模板内容:<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ta http-equiv="X-UA-Com
转载 2023-12-18 23:45:11
76阅读
# Python jinjia2解析路径 ## 概述 在Python中,jinjia2是一种流行的模板引擎,它可以帮助我们实现动态的Web页面。本文将通过以下步骤教你如何使用jinjia2解析路径。 ## 步骤 下面是整个实现过程的步骤: | 步骤 | 描述 | | --- | --- | | 1 | 导入所需的库 | | 2 | 创建一个jinjia2环境 | | 3 | 定义模板 | |
原创 2024-01-22 06:17:26
204阅读
一、集合类型及操作1、集合类型定义-集合类型与数学中的集合概念一致 -集合元素之间无序,每个元素唯一,不存在相同元素 -集合元素不可更改,不能是可变数据类型 -集合用大括号{}表示,元素用逗号分隔 -建立集合类型用{}或set() -建立空集合类型,必须使用set()举例A = {"python",123,("python",123)} print(A) B = set("pypy123")#使
 讲师:邱彦涛;项目经理:春生;班主任:任安安;银角大王:武sir;金角大王:Alex;肖锋:Python web 框架;马老师:数据库+框架+数据库;赵博士:清华大学计算机博士;  一  学习内容简介 python的来源,历史发展如何编程python的程序如何编写变量。变量的命名规范常量(写法)变量的数据类型(int,str,bool)用户交互(
转载 2023-08-16 23:30:29
68阅读
## 实现Python Jinja中的if判断字符串包含 作为一名经验丰富的开发者,帮助新手学习如何在Python Jinja中实现if条件判断字符串包含是一项很重要的任务。在本文中,我将指导你完成这个任务,并提供详细的步骤和示例代码。 ### 流程图 ```mermaid erDiagram 开始 --> 安装Jinja 安装Jinja --> 导入模板 导入模板
原创 2024-03-25 07:32:49
835阅读
...
翻译 2021-06-15 23:49:00
1164阅读
# 使用 Jinja2 渲染 Python 文档教程 在本教程中,我们将学习如何使用 Jinja2 模板引擎来创建和渲染文档。Jinja2 是一个非常强大的 Python 模板引擎,适用于生成动态 HTML、XML 或其他文件格式的文本。通过本指南,你将获得 Jinja2 的基本使用步骤和代码示例。 ## 整体流程 在开始之前,我们需要明确实现 Jinja2 文档所需的步骤。以下是整个流程表
原创 2024-09-19 05:07:19
98阅读
Ansible 是一个非常流行的基础设施自动化工具,而 Jinja2 是其默认的模板引擎。Ansible 和 Jinja2 的结合,为用户提供了强大的自动化能力,使得管理和部署基础设施变得更加简单和高效。 Jinja2 是一种基于 Python 的模板引擎,它使用非常简单直观的语法来定义模板。在 Ansible 中,Jinja2 被广泛应用于模板文件和 playbooks 中的变量替换和逻辑控制
原创 2024-02-28 09:32:47
87阅读
特性沙箱中执行强大的 HTML 自动转义系统保护系统免受 XSS模板继承及时编译最优的 python 代码可选提前编译模板的时间易于调试。异常的行数直接指向模板中的对应行。可配置的语法安装MarkupSafe替代Jinja2中老的加速模块,模块尽量安装c的版本; 基本API使用,通过 Template 创建一个模板并渲染它; 如果你的模板不是从字符串加载,而是文件系统或别的数据源,无论如何这都不是
转载 2023-10-01 13:19:22
199阅读
随着企业对测试工程师的能力要求日渐增长,对我们每一位测试工程师而言既是压力也是提升的动力,不提升就意味着没有出路,没有发展!我们职业发展的命运是靠自己的能力来把握的,而不是一味的惧怕高要求,惧怕难技术。因为只有高和难才能成就“高薪”,否则只有等待“岁月催人老”了,测试能力的提升是最最关键的头等大事!一、如何提升测试技术?各种各样的测试技术浩如烟海,何时才能有大的突破?掌握到何种程度才能成为企业所需
# 使用Jinja2生成C语言模板的探索之旅 在现代软件开发中,模板引擎的使用已经成为一种普遍的实践,特别是在代码生成、Web开发和文档编制等方面。Jinja2是一个流行的Python模板引擎,它使得生成各种类型文件变得更加高效和灵活。在这篇文章中,我们将探讨如何使用Jinja2生成C语言代码模板,并通过一些示例和图表来辅助说明。 ## Jinja2简介 Jinja2是一个用于Python
原创 2024-09-20 14:24:36
475阅读
Ansible Template使用jinjia2格式。 还可以使用jinjia2的filter来实现跟进一步的功能扩展: | to_json | to_nice_json | to_yaml | to_nice_yaml 基本语法: {% for i in range(1,10)%} server
转载 2020-03-29 11:14:00
210阅读
2评论
ansible setup 内置jinjia变量
原创 2019-06-21 16:05:59
2397阅读
# 使用 Jinja2 模板渲染 HTML 并处理图片缺失 在现代 веб 开发中,渲染动态内容是提高用户体验的重要手段之一。我们通常使用模板引擎来达到这个目的,Python 中最流行的模板引擎之一是 Jinja2。本文将探讨如何使用 Jinja2 渲染 HTML 并处理图片缺失的情况,最后给出一个代码示例,展示如何显示默认图片。 ## 一、Jinja2 简介 Jinja2 是一个现代的、设
原创 7月前
114阅读
渲染模板:在flask中渲染模板很简单!!!首先导入render_template模块,然后把html文件放入templates
原创 2019-09-03 17:09:38
26阅读
Python Flask (二)一、使用路由和视图函数1.1 路由的概念1.2 定义一个路由1.3 使用 动态路由1.4 视图函数的响应二、模板2.1 Jinjia2 模板初体验2.2 变量2.3 使用过滤器学习内容来自 —— Flask Web 开发 :基于Python的Web应用、
原创 2021-09-03 14:33:43
1356阅读
文章目录GitHub项目地址成果展示计算器功能1: 计算并把结果存入后端数据库功能2: 回退清零功能3:错误提示功能4:读取历史记录利率计算器存款贷款设计实现过程代码实现前端:使用HTML+CSS + JS 进行页面设计计算器利率后端:使用Python+ Flask进行编写数据库心得体会 GitHub项目地址前端:-/calculator.html at main · 102101243/- (
转载 8月前
22阅读
结合mysql数据库查询,实现分页效果@user.route("/user_list",methods=['POST','GET'])def user_list(): p = g.args.get("p", '') #页数 show_shouye_status = 0 #显示首页状态 if p =='': p=1 else: p=int(p) if ...
原创 2021-08-31 15:50:07
566阅读
  • 1
  • 2
  • 3
  • 4
  • 5